The graduation of the third shift, usually termed the night time shift, usually falls throughout the late night to early morning hours. A standard beginning time is 11:00 PM, concluding round 7:00 AM the next day, though variations exist relying on the particular {industry} and employer. This shift typically covers the interval when a lot of the inhabitants is asleep.
The importance of this in a single day work interval lies in sustaining steady operations in sectors equivalent to manufacturing, healthcare, safety, and transportation. Advantages embrace facilitating round the clock service and accommodating processes which are extra effectively carried out in periods of decrease demand or decreased congestion.
